Transaction 2dcbb1584b7331a3a3e7edd608178d7640c73dfd8441af482b08d02379980268
1 Input
1 Output
-
2dcbb1584b7331a3a3e7edd608178d7640c73dfd8441af482b08d02379980268:0
- value
- 28605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e047fa74a652a420496ab41a9d43f5a780faab89 OP_EQUAL
- address
- 3N8uWf3K2H4W7ivz36JYcK7tBPnm39889h